ABB, Davos collaborate for sustainable mobility

DUBAI, January 22, 2018

ABB, a pioneering technology leader, and the city of Davos, Switzerland, have teamed up in a long-term partnership to provide an e-infrastructure for public and private transportation at this year’s annual World Economic Forum (WEF).

The forum will take place from January 23 to 26.

Davos residents and WEF guests can experience the pioneering TOSA bus for themselves. The award-winning TOSA bus, developed by ABB in Switzerland, is already in use in Geneva and will soon be implemented in the French city of Nantes, said a statement.

The bus can recharge its battery in just 20 seconds as passengers board and disembark. In Davos, it will operate on the busy Line 1, running from the tourist centre to the hospital, it said.

This is the first time TOSA technology is being used in an Alpine region. The idea is to run the system under extreme winter weather conditions; ABB and its project partners expect to gain valuable insights from this pilot project, it added.

In addition, eight ABB fast-charging stations with both AC and DC have been provided for electric cars. The fast-charging infrastructure has been installed in high-traffic areas throughout the greater Davos area.

The TOSA technology received the prestigious Swiss energy award – the 2018 Watt d’Or – in Bern on January 11, 2018. – TradeArabia News Service
